MyLaps-Ready Compact Timing – MRT Transponder for RC Racing

If you need a rechargeable racing transponder-style timing solution for compatible RC car events, this MRT unit is built around MyLaps AMBrc and RC4 systems up through v4.4. Its tiny 19 x 16 x 6 mm footprint and 4-gram weight make it easy to tuck into a race chassis without adding much bulk.

Best For: RC racers using AMBrc or RC4 timing systems through v4.4 who want a very small, lightweight transponder.

Pros:

  • Compatible with AMBrc systems and RC4 up to v4.4
  • Very compact at 19 x 16 x 6 mm
  • Extremely light at 4 grams
  • Includes two stored ID numbers, with a custom ID set at the factory

Cons:

  • Will not work with the v4.5 Drone System update
  • Not described as rechargeable in the supplied notes
  • Requires matching race timing hardware to be useful

For racers staying on supported AMBrc/RC4 versions, this is a straightforward, low-profile transponder option. The main limitation is compatibility, so it’s best chosen only when your track’s system matches the supported range.

Key Buying Factors for a Rechargeable Racing Transponder

Compatibility

Always confirm your timing system first. A Rechargeable Racing Transponder is only useful if it works with your race organizer’s hardware, whether that means MyLaps RC4, RC3, AMB, Westhold, or another platform.

Power and Charging

Look at battery runtime, recharge speed, and whether the unit is USB-charged, charger-included, or direct powered. If you race often, a model with simple charging and long run time can save time between heats.

Mounting and Form Factor

Consider where the transponder will sit on the vehicle or bike. Compact units, direct-powered designs, and options with mounting pouches or hardware can make installation much easier.

Durability

For outdoor or high-contact racing, water resistance, dust resistance, and tough housings matter. A durable transponder is less likely to fail from vibration, debris, or rough handling.
